UEI College-Gardena
UEI College-Gardena is a Private, 2-4 years located in Gardena, CA. UEI College-Gardena is accredited by Accrediting Commission of Career Schools and Colleges.
- The 2025 tuition & fees of UEI College-Gardena is $19,900 where the average tuition & fees of all community colleges is $8,737.
- The tuition & fees stays same as last year at UEI College-Gardena.
- Total 1,332 students have enrolled in UEI College-Gardena and, of that, 138 students enrolled online exclusively.
- UEI College-Gardena offers 11 programs.
- The graduation rate of UEI College-Gardena is 60% where the average graduation rate of all community colleges is 40.6%.

Student Population
Total 1,332 students have enrolled to UEI College-Gardena. By gender, there are 762 male and 570 female students are attending the school. The male to female ratio is 1.34 to 1.

Important Academic Statistics
The graduation rate at UEI College-Gardena is 60% and the transfer-out rate is 1%. The average financial aid amount is $4,663 and 90% of students received grant aid (any source). The next table shows the important statistics at the school.
| Graduation Rate | 60% |
|---|---|
| Transfer-out Rate | 1% |
| Retention Rate | 73% |
| Financial Aid Amount | $4,663 |
| Students to Faculty Ratio | 23 to 1 |
| Number of Faculty (full-time) | 20 |
| Number of Staff (full-time) | 54 |
